One of the common reasons is that permissions are not set correctly. On GitLab, each project has its own permission settings, and if permissions are not set correctly, the project cannot be pulled down. This usually happens when a new project or team is initialized. Make sure you have been granted access to the project or group. You can view a project's member and group settings on the project's settings page or in the GitLab admin panel.

Another reason may be using the wrong clone address. In GitLab, you can use various clone addresses such as HTTPS URL, SSH URL, etc. If you use the wrong address, you won't be able to pull the project from GitLab. Make sure your clone address is correct, you can find it on your project's GitLab page or in GitLab's "Clone" button.

Additionally, you may experience network connection or server issues while downloading items. If you can't access GitLab or have problems with the GitLab server, you won't be able to pull projects from GitLab. You can try checking if there are any issues via GitLab's System Status page or by contacting GitLab support.

How to generate ssh keys in git How to generate ssh keys in git Apr 17, 2025 pm 01:36 PM

In order to securely connect to a remote Git server, an SSH key containing both public and private keys needs to be generated. The steps to generate an SSH key are as follows: Open the terminal and enter the command ssh-keygen -t rsa -b 4096. Select the key saving location. Enter a password phrase to protect the private key. Copy the public key to the remote server. Save the private key properly because it is the credentials for accessing the account.

How to check the warehouse address of git How to check the warehouse address of git Apr 17, 2025 pm 01:54 PM

To view the Git repository address, perform the following steps: 1. Open the command line and navigate to the repository directory; 2. Run the "git remote -v" command; 3. View the repository name in the output and its corresponding address.
